The Hard Milling & Mirror Finish Demand
The Industry Pain: Modern mold making is shifting away from EDM towards direct hard milling of pre-hardened steels (like S136, H13). The goal is to achieve surface roughness (Ra) values below 0.2µm directly from the machine [Referring to Module 4, Image 1]. However, vibration or thermal drift during long finishing passes destroys this finish, leading to hours of manual polishing.Complex Geometries & Corner Clearing
The Industry Pain: Molds for consumer electronics or bottle caps often feature deep cavities, sharp corners, and complex undercuts [Referring to Module 4, Image 5]. Standard 3-axis machining necessitates multiple setups and long EDM processes with copper electrodes [Referring to Module 4, Image 3], which increases lead time and cumulative errors.Accuracy Retention Over Long Cycles
The Industry Pain: Machining a large stamping die block or a multi-cavity mold plate [Referring to Module 4, Image 2 & 4] can take 20 to 50 hours of continuous cutting. As the machine runs, ambient temperature changes and spindle heat cause thermal expansion. Even a 10-micron drift can ruin the parting line fit or cause flash on the final plastic part.
